Part 1: Defining Your Needs — Why Go "High Performance"?

Standard plastic household items are fundamentally different from industrial-grade precision parts. High performance plastic injection molding is typically employed to handle extreme conditions such as:

  • Extreme Temperatures: Continuous operating environments exceeding 150°C, and sometimes reaching over 300°C.

  • Harsh Chemical Corrosion: Exposure to strong acids, alkalis, or industrial solvents.

  • High Mechanical Loads: The need to replace metal to reduce weight while maintaining exceptional tensile strength and stiffness.

  • Tight Dimensional Tolerances: Errors at critical mating interfaces must be controlled within ±0.01mm.

Before launching a project, defining these boundary conditions is the bedrock of all subsequent work.

Part 2: High-Performance Material Selection Checklist

In the process of high performance plastic injection molding, material selection is the first and most critical step. Below is a comparison table of industry-recognized high-end materials and their ideal applications:

High-Performance Material Comparison Reference

Property PEEK (Polyetheretherketone) PPS (Polyphenylene Sulfide) PPA (High-Temp Nylon) PEI (Polyetherimide)
Max Continuous Use Temp 250°C - 260°C 200°C - 220°C 120°C - 150°C 170°C - 180°C
Chemical Resistance Excellent (Virtually inert) Outstanding (Acid/Alkali) Good (Oil/Fuel res.) Excellent (Fuel/Acid res.)
Mechanical Strength Extremely High (Fatigue res.) High (Stable & Hard) Higher (Good Toughness) High (Great Tensile)
Typical Applications Aerospace, Medical Implants Automotive Engine, Housing Fuel Systems, Pumps Aircraft Interiors, Medical
Cost Assessment Premium / Very High Medium-High Medium High

Part 3: DFM (Design for Manufacturing) Principles for High-Performance Molding

To achieve optimal results in high performance plastic injection molding, product designs must adhere to specific physical laws. Here are four core principles summarized by the GZ-BOST engineering team:

1. Wall Thickness Uniformity

High-performance plastics like PEEK or LCP are highly sensitive to cooling rates. Uneven wall thickness leads to residual internal stress, which causes warpage. It is recommended to keep thickness variations within 15%.

2. Ribs Design

Instead of increasing overall wall thickness, use strategic rib designs to enhance strength. Typically, rib thickness should be 40%-60% of the adjoining wall thickness to prevent surface sink marks.

3. Draft Angles

Since high-performance materials are often rigid and have low shrinkage rates, a proper draft angle is vital for ejection. We generally recommend a minimum of 1° to 2°, with larger angles required for textured surfaces.

4. Gate Location Selection

The gate location dictates molecular orientation. When handling high performance plastic injection molding, ensure the gate is placed at the thickest cross-section to allow for adequate packing pressure.

Part 4: Controlling Key Variables in Production

A high-quality guide must demonstrate a deep understanding of actual factory floor operations. High-performance molding is not a "set and forget" operation; it relies on precise control of these variables:

1. Stringent Dehumidification Drying

Many high-performance engineering plastics are hygroscopic. Even 0.02% moisture can cause hydrolysis during processing at 350°C, leading to strength degradation or surface splay. We require all materials to undergo 4-6 hours of deep dehumidified drying.

2. Mold Temperature Management

Unlike standard molding which uses cooling water, high performance plastic injection molding often requires oil heaters to raise mold temperatures above 150°C. This is the only way for materials to reach ideal crystallinity, ensuring long-term dimensional stability.

3. Multi-Stage Injection Pressure Control

These materials often have high viscosity. By segmenting injection speeds and using multi-stage packing pressure, air pockets can be eliminated, and complex micro-features can be fully filled.

Part 5: How to Evaluate a Supplier’s True Capability?

When searching for a partner, look beyond the quote. As a savvy buyer, you should inspect three dimensions:

  • Hardware Facilities: Do they have injection machines modified for high-temperature and high-pressure environments? Are the screws coated for corrosion resistance?

  • Technical Support: Can they provide detailed Moldflow analysis reports? Do they offer DFM optimization suggestions?

  • Quality Systems: Do they hold ISO 9001 or higher industry certifications? Do they use Coordinate Measuring Machines (CMM) for high-precision verification?

How do I select the appropriate engineering plastic grade for my product?

Selection should be based on parameters such as load conditions (e.g., pressure/friction), temperature range, medium contact (e.g., oil/acid), and regulatory requirements (e.g., FDA/RoHS). Our engineers can provide free material selection consulting and sample testing.
